Class: TRMNLP::Commands::Build
- Defined in:
- lib/trmnlp/commands/build.rb
Instance Method Summary collapse
Methods inherited from Base
Constructor Details
This class inherits a constructor from TRMNLP::Commands::Base
Instance Method Details
#call ⇒ Object
6 7 8 9 10 11 12 13 14 15 16 17 18 |
# File 'lib/trmnlp/commands/build.rb', line 6 def call context.validate! context.poll_data context.paths.create_build_dir VIEWS.each do |view| output_path = context.paths.build_dir.join("#{view}.html") output "Writing #{output_path}..." output_path.write(context.render_full_page(view)) end output "Done!" end |